This is actually how the Camelbak was born (acording to an article I read in
Mountain Bike magazine last fall). Apparently, the patent-holders of the
Camelbak were Mountain Bikers competing in the very very dry 24-hours of
Moab race a few years back. One guy was an EMT and the other an Engineer --
before the race, they concocted the first ever Camelbak out of an IV bag and
surgical tubing, which they inserted into an old gym sock, which they then
tied to their backs. A multimillion dollar idea was born.
